Which natural features are near the property?

Ginninderra Creek runs through the centre of Macgregor for roughly 1.4 km, and Goodwin Hill, a local mountain, lies about 0.5 km away, offering scenic walks and views

How is Macgregor positioned relative to major roads?

The suburb is bounded by Florey Drive to the east, Ginninderra Drive to the north, and Southern Cross Drive to the south, providing easy access to surrounding areas

What type of geological formation underlies the area?

The land is covered by Silurian‑age Deakin Volcanics, specifically purple rhyodacite, which is common throughout Macgregor

What is the demographic profile of Macgregor?

According to the 2016 census, Macgregor had about 6,800 residents with a median age of 32 years, a strong presence of young families, and over 80 % of households occupying separate houses
